P.S. Picture included taken just recently, is in my backyard on Sweet William. This is a Two-tailed Swallowtail, one of four Swallowtails occurring in the Okanagan area, my recent research tells me. Swallowtails are steady visitors to my backyard each summer and are especially fond of the Sweet William there. They spend far more time on it than anything else, giving me good opportunities to get some pictures.
